Default No throttle response

My cruise control keep blinking on dash
when it happens I have no throttle
2009 road king classic

the throttle body has a plug at the 7 oclock position ( feel behind the air cleaner).

unplug this and clean the contacts on both sides.

I use a fiberglass nic-sand pen ( some use contact cleaner spray...make SURE that it is plastic safe)

put it back on.( some use a dielectric grease)

then cycle the ignition 4 times to reset the throttle position

with right hand, turn on ignition switch...wait until fuel pump primes and stops...wait a sec...turn ign switch off.

repeat

this is all assuming that nobody has tried ( and failed) to wire up a bar swap
